North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market
North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market by Shape (Torpedo, Laminar Flow Body, Streamlined Rectangular Style, Multi-Hull), Type (Shallow, Medium, Large), System, Speed, Propulsion, Application, Cost, and Country – Forecast to 2030
OVERVIEW
Source: Secondary Research, Interviews with Experts, MarketsandMarkets Analysis
The North America autonomous underwater vehicle market is expected to reach USD 1.12 billion by 2030, from USD 0.75 billion in 2025, with a CAGR of 8.3%. In terms of volume, it will likely rise from 219 units in 2025 to 313 units by 2030. This growth is driven by increasing naval modernization programs, growing demand for deep-water intelligence and seabed mapping, and expanding use of AUVs in offshore energy inspection and environmental monitoring applications.

Driver: Growing naval demand for autonomous undersea surveillance and reconnaissance
North American defense agencies are increasing investments in AUVs to strengthen undersea domain awareness and counter emerging submarine threats. These platforms provide covert, long-duration intelligence collection at lower operational cost than manned assets. This demand is accelerating procurement across both the US and Canada.
Restraint: High procurement and lifecycle costs for advanced AUV platforms
AUVs equipped with high-end navigation, sonar, and propulsion systems require substantial upfront capital and recurring maintenance expenditure. These costs limit adoption among smaller operators and research institutions. Budget constraints can slow fleet expansion, particularly for large and deep-water vehicles.
Opportunity: Expansion of AUV use in offshore wind and subsea energy projects in US and Canada
North America’s accelerating offshore wind build-out and aging subsea energy infrastructure are creating strong demand for autonomous inspection, survey, and maintenance missions. AUVs offer safer and more cost-efficient alternatives to manned diving or ROV operations. This shift is expected to open new commercial revenue pools for AUV suppliers.
Challenge: Difficult operating conditions in Arctic and deep-water environments
Harsh temperatures, ice coverage, and low-visibility waters in the Arctic region pose navigation and endurance challenges for AUV deployments. Deep-water missions also strain sensor performance and increase mission risk. These conditions require specialized designs and raise operational complexity for North American operators.

North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market, By Type
Large AUVs operating beyond 1,000 m depth dominate the North American market, as their extended endurance, long-range navigation, and higher payload capacity make them suitable for deep-sea exploration, naval ISR missions, and subsea infrastructure surveys. Their ability to perform autonomous operations in complex environments positions them as the preferred class for defense and scientific applications.
North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market, By Shape
The torpedo-shaped configuration holds the largest share due to its hydrodynamic efficiency, reduced drag, and ability to sustain long-endurance missions. This design is widely adopted for military surveillance, oceanographic mapping, and offshore energy inspection, enabling stable operations even in strong currents and deep-water conditions.
North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market, By Propulsion
Electric AUVs surpass other segments, supported by advancements in battery chemistry, improved energy density, and enhanced power management systems. Their low-acoustic signature, high reliability, and suitability for both defense missions and long-duration scientific surveys make them preferred across North America.
North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market, By System
Payload & sensor lead the North American market, driven by demand for high-resolution sonar, synthetic aperture sonar, optical imaging, and advanced oceanographic sensors. These systems are critical for seabed mapping, environmental monitoring, and defense reconnaissance, making them the highest-value components of AUV platforms.
North America Autonomous Underwater Vehicle Market, By Application
Military & defense remain the largest segment, bolstered by rising investments in autonomous ISR, mine countermeasures, and undersea domain awareness programs. North American defense agencies increasingly rely on AUVs to enhance maritime security, monitor strategic waters, and support multi-mission autonomous operations.

RECENT DEVELOPMENTS
- January 2025 : HII (US) announced a new production contract with the US Navy for additional REMUS 300 units under the Maritime Expeditionary Standoff Response program, enhancing autonomous mine countermeasure capabilities and accelerating fleet-wide AUV adoption.
- September 2024 : Kraken Robotics (Canada) secured a contract from the Royal Canadian Navy to supply its KATFISH towed synthetic aperture sonar and support AUV-based seabed intelligence missions, strengthening domestic autonomous underwater surveillance and mapping capabilities.
- June 2024 : L3Harris Technologies, Inc. (US) completed a major upgrade to its Iver4 AUV platform, integrating advanced autonomy software, long-endurance battery modules, and enhanced navigation systems to support US defense, hydrographic, and offshore energy customers.

Market Definition
An north america autonomous underwater vehicle is a self-propelled, untethered underwater robotic platform capable of independent navigation and task execution without real-time human control, used for applications such as seafloor mapping, inspection, surveillance, and data collection across defense, research, and commercial domains.
